Macmillan Charity Campaign Video for 1000 Mile Bike Ride

May 19, 2023 Christopher Bevan

YSP Media has just completed work on a promotional video for a charity campaign to raise money for Macmillan Cancer Support. Derby-based Damien Ransome will be taking on a 1000 mile bike ride, travelling the length of the UK from Land’s End to John O’Groats in a so-called ‘Iron Butt Challenge’.

To date Damien has raised over £1000 for Macmillan through charitable donations from individuals and businesses. YSP Media’s Christopher Bevan was approached by Damien’s wife Pam to produce the video and we were absolutely committed to getting involved and supporting this worthy cause. Filming took place in Long Eaton at the Roy Pidcock BMW dealership which allowed for us to capture footage of the showroom, workshop and Damien’s interview with BBC Radio Derby to promote the charity challenge he is taking on.
